HC Deb 02 July 1986 vol 100 cc530-1W
Mr. Onslow

asked the Secretary of State for the Environment what steps he takes to monitor the levels of water abstraction for agricultural purposes from rivers in England and Wales.

Mr. John Patten

It is for water authorities to monitor water resources and to license abstractions (other than their own), which are controlled under the Water Resources Act 1963. Most agricultural abstractions are however exempt from licensing.
